How Driving Behaviour Accelerates Tyre Wear
Cornering Forces and Edge Wear
When a car is cornering hard, the tyres experience considerable side forces. Usually, these forces during a turn rest on the tyre's outer edges, thereby damaging one area of the tyre, and this damage happens faster than the wear in other parts of the tread. Those who take corners with a higher-than-normal speed will find that the outer shoulder of the tyre shows signs of wear even before the centre tread has hardly met the minimum legal requirement. Therefore, altering the cornering pattern, combined with timely tyre rotation, will allow the entire tread to wear more uniformly.
Braking Patterns and Flat Spotting
Stressing the brakes repeatedly and heavily can cause the area of the tyre that contacts the road to get very hot. This repeated heating and cooling of the rubber can cause the breakdown of the compound in a small area. Also, instances where the brake force is so great that the wheels stop rotating cause a flat spot to occur. This is a kind of uneven tyre wear caused by the fact that the rubber keeps rubbing the road surface in the same spot without rolling. Nowadays, most cars are equipped with ABS, which ensures that no wheel locks up fully, but still, heavy and aggressive braking leads to a concentration of heat and wear. This mainly occurs at the front part of the contact patch, to a greater extent than if braking were continuous and gradual.
Environmental Factors That Affect Compound Integrity
One of the crucial aspects to consider is that where a car is used and stored matters for tyre life, regardless of how far the vehicle has been driven.
UV Exposure and Ozone Degradation
Sunlight and ozone in the air deteriorate tyre rubber over time. Vehicles standing outside without a cover always develop cracks on the surfaces of their tyres faster than those that are parked in a garage or under a tree. If a tyre surface is exposed to ultraviolet light, the damage to the tyre will extend beyond the surface, and the cords underneath could become compromised. Tyres with a good tread but badly cracked walls may be very dangerous, no matter how deep the tread is.
Road Surface Abrasiveness
Rougher stretches of tarmac will wear away the rubber more quickly than a nice, smooth bit of road. If a driver frequents village roads or newly road-surfaced stretches where the aggregate has been left exposed, the tyres will wear much more quickly than those of a driver who mainly travels on motorway roads. It explains why tyre mileage figures provided by manufacturers are estimates produced under average conditions, while specific surfaces may confront individual drivers during their journeys.
Selecting Tyres That Match Actual Usage
Your choice of a tyre should primarily focus on the vehicle's normal operating conditions rather than just the price or the brand name, as it greatly affects both the car's performance and the tyre's durability.
Choosing the Right Compound Based on the Journey
People who mainly do short city trips should go for a compound that can provide sufficient traction quickly without the need for a long warm-up. For instance, a high-performance tyre built for continuous motorway speeds might not get warm enough during short trips and therefore give less grip compared to a touring-type tyre, which is designed for such use. Making a selection of the compound type that really fits the journey patterns instead of focusing on performance potential will lead to enhanced safety and better wear characteristics in everyday use.

Signs That Indicate Replacement Is Overdue
Knowing which signs to look for leads to an earlier response long before a worn tyre becomes a safety hazard.
- When the steering wheel feels like it's vibrating at motorway speeds, it is a sign of wear pattern mismatches that have gone past the point where rebalancing can fix the issue.
- A marked increase in road noise being heard is an indication of tread block irregularity coming from uneven wear rather than the smooth, progressive wear that leads to constant noise levels.
- If the car veers towards one side without you turning the wheel, it means a considerable difference in tread depth or tyre pressure between the two tyres on the same axle.
- Wear indicators being at the level of the adjacent tread show that the tyre has reached its legal minimum, and replacement should be done as soon as possible before further use.
